j2ee转安卓开发后悔了

J2EE(Java 2 Platform Enterprise Edition)是一种Java平台,用于开发和运行大型分布式应用程序。它是一种业界标准,用于开发高性能,可扩展且灵活的应用程序。

安卓开发是现在非常热门的技术之一,它涉及到的知识更加广泛。有很多人在学习J2EE之后选择进入安卓开发行业,但是可能会在这个过程中后悔,因为J2EE和安卓开发涉及到的知识领域有很大的不同,下面我们来具体了解一下。

J2EE是一种用于构建大型企业级应用程序的技术。它包括Java Servlet,JavaServer Pages(JSP),Enterprise JavaBeans(EJB)等组件,使它能够满足企业级应用程序的需求。J2EE应用程序可在Web服务器上运行,例如Weblogic,Tomcat等。

安卓开发则涉及到各种技术,包括Java编程语言,Android SDK,Android Studio等技术。安卓开发目的是开发响应式设计和更好的用户体验的移动应用程序。安卓应用程序可在Android设备上运行。

J2EE在企业应用程序的开发方面具有很强的优势,在安卓开发方面却无法发挥太大作用。这是因为在安卓应用程序中,需要开发一些非常具体的UI设计和交互,以及更加接近具体的应用实现和逻辑部分。安卓开发涉及到的领域不仅仅包括编程语言本身,还包括响应式设计,性能调优和用户体验等方面的知识。

对于那些只有J2EE背景的开发人员来说,他们可能不具备在安卓方面进行UI设计和用户体验的能力。这意味着,他们在开发过程中会遇到大量的挑战,需要在开发中学习和适应很多新的技术。

在进行安卓开发时,需要开发高度交互和非常具体的界面设计,这就需要高度的创造力和技术实现能力。在J2EE开发过程中,这些方面往往受到限制,因为企业应用程序的设计需要依靠通用的界面设计指南和企业技术标准,使其适应各种不同的企业环境。

因此,对于想从J2EE转到安卓开发行业的人来说,可能会发现他们需要学习大量的全新知识和技能,这可能会使他们感到不适应。另外,由于安卓开发市场非常竞争,这也会使新手遇到很多财务和工作的挑战。

总之,从J2EE转到安卓开发是一个非常艰难的决定。虽然这种转变可能会为你带来新的挑战和机会,但是你需要做好充分的准备。在这个过程中,你需要全面地了解安卓开发所涉及的领域,并发展自己在UI设计、交互和用户体验等方面的能力。

川公网安备 51019002001728号